They've created spreadsheets to track sales, expenditures, and profits, made signs, and set prices based on their costs. After a lesson on counting back change, they now feel very professional using a real cash register.\r\n\r\nWe even designated an accountant who inputs data, makes deposits, and shares weekly updates. The students have shown impressive responsibility, showing up for their scheduled shifts on time or finding someone to cover when they can't make it.\r\n\r\nOne of their favorite additions has been the button maker! They've created buttons that promote the positive character traits we're focusing on. They assembled the machine themselves and learned how it works. Next, we'll be working with the press, where they'll get to see their creative ideas come to life in something useful and functional.\r\n\r\nTheir enthusiasm and pride in what they've built is truly inspiring. The story's themes of family, responsibility, and perseverance are deeply impactful for our students, and having a personal copy allows them to engage with the text more meaningfully—annotating, reflecting, and truly connecting with Timothy's journey.\r\n\r\nWhat makes House Arrest especially powerful is its format as a novel in verse. Poetry strips the language down to its emotional core, allowing students to connect with the story on a more personal and visceral level. The brevity and rhythm of the text draw in even the most hesitant readers, while the raw, honest voice of the protagonist invites thoughtful reflection. Verse allows students to slow down, sit with the meaning of each line, and find their own voice in the silence between the words. It's a form that not only tells a story but invites students to feel it—and that emotional connection is where deep, lasting learning takes place.","fullyFundedDate":1744206355935,"projectUrl":"project/arresting-students-in-a-book/9229967/","projectTitle":"Arresting Students in a Book","teacherDisplayName":"Mrs. Romans","teacherPhotoUrl":"https://storage.donorschoose.net/dc_prod/images/teacher/profile/orig/tp9101201_orig.jpg?crop=420,420,x0,y0&width=272&height=272&fit=bounds&auto=webp&t=1692581062225","teacherClassroomUrl":"classroom/romans"},{"teacherId":9101201,"projectId":9229344,"letterContent":"On behalf of our entire class, I want to extend our heartfelt thanks for your generous contribution toward the purchase of The Call of the Wild book set.
